Market Data Engineer
Millennium Management
As Market Data Engineer you will support and optimize real-time market data environments to enable fast, reliable trading workflows. You will partner with portfolio managers, trading desks, and tech teams to meet evolving data needs and drive platform enhancements. Your work spans low-latency processing, data distribution, and automation of operational processes to improve stability and speed. This role sits at the core of Millennium's SPEED Data team, shaping the technical direction of market data infrastructure. You will impact how efficiently the firm consumes and distributes market data across global environments.
Responsibilities- Support and manage enterprise and latency-sensitive real-time market data environments
- Partner with Portfolio Managers, trading desks, and tech teams to address market data needs
- Shape the team's technical direction through platform enhancements and initiatives
- Collaborate with hardware and software teams to build real-time processing and distribution systems
- Optimize platform performance to reduce latency and improve reliability
- Design and build tools for monitoring, metrics, visualization, and self-service administration
- Improve operational processes including release management, incident response, and SLA enforcement
- Contribute to the stability and evolution of the global market data plant across environments
- Experience supporting market data environments in a global organization with feed handlers and distribution infrastructure
- Strong knowledge of market data concepts, data models, messaging protocols, order book structures, recovery, and reliability
- Hands-on experience with Bloomberg and Thomson Reuters platforms
- Site reliability engineering or operational expertise including automation and release/deployment management
- Experience with monitoring and metrics for distributed market data platforms
- Degree in Computer Science or related field with object-oriented programming or scripting experience
- Solid understanding of Linux internals, networking, and CPU architecture in high-performance systems
- Strong prioritization, communication, relationship management, and ownership in fast-paced environments
